Извлечь весь JSON с помощью JSONPath? - PullRequest
0 голосов
/ 23 октября 2018

Я должен использовать JSONPath в моей реализации.Как извлечь весь JSON как есть?

Мой JSON

[{"data":"xxx#12#1","id":"7_0_0"},
 {"data":"xxx#12#1","id":"8_0_1"},
 {"data":"xxx#12#1","id":"9_1_0"},
 {"data":"xxx#12#1","id":"10_1_1"},
 {"data":"xxx#12#1","id":"11_2_0"},
 {"data":"xxx#12#1","id":"12_2_1"}]

Например, когда я пытаюсь с путем

$..*

, я получил JSON

[
 {
"data": "xxx#12#1",
"id": "7_0_0"
 },
 {
"data": "xxx#12#1",
"id": "8_0_1"
 },
 {
"data": "xxx#12#1",
"id": "9_1_0"
 },
 {
"data": "xxx#12#1",
"id": "10_1_1"
 },
 {
"data": "xxx#12#1",
"id": "11_2_0"
 },
 {
"data": "xxx#12#1",
"id": "12_2_1"
 },
 "xxx#12#1",
 "7_0_0",
 "xxx#12#1",
 "8_0_1",
 "xxx#12#1",
 "9_1_0",
 "xxx#12#1",
 "10_1_1",
 "xxx#12#1",
 "11_2_0",
 "xxx#12#1",
 "12_2_1"
 ]

Итак, в конце JSON есть дополнительные поля.

https://goessner.net/articles/JsonPath/index.html

http://jsonpath.com/

1 Ответ

0 голосов
/ 23 октября 2018

Когда я использую путь

*

, я получаю весь JSON.

...